← ScienceWhich consequence results when stellar nucleosynthesis reduces binding energy?
A)Fusion ceases at Iron-56✓
B)Neutron star crustal fragmentation
C)Supernova inward collapse stops
D)Black hole event horizon expands
💡 Explanation
The fusion process is exothermic only up to Iron-56; beyond generates energy input due to nuclear binding energy. Therefore stellar fusion effectively halts rather than proceeding to heavier elements because further fusion requires more rather than releases energy.
